The state’s Fine Wine & Good Spirits stores closed on March 17 and remained that way until only recently. Even now, a number of stores primarily in the eastern part of the state remain closed.

Two weeks later, the state resumed online sales, and three weeks after that began curbside pickup. Stores began to reopen a few weeks ago as counties began to switch out of Gov. Tom Wolf’s red, or stay-at-home, phase.

So what did consumers buy from the Pennsylvania Liquor Control Board (PLCB) over the past couple of months?

Here’s a list of the top 10 wines and liquors sold online, curbside, and through the stores (curbside and in-person), with the dates noted atop each list.

E-commerce only, April 1-July 8

Wines

Includes the product, liquid volume, sales amount and sales quantity

1, La Marca Prosecco-750 ml-$71,145-4,397

2, Decoy Cabernet Sauvignon Sonoma County-750 ml-$49,106-2,172

3, Mionetto Prosecco Brut-750 ml-$46,316-3,242

4, Robert Mondavi Winery Cabernet Sauvignon Monterey County Aged in Bourbon Barrels-750 ml-$45,780-3,165

5, Moet and Chandon Imperial Champagne Brut-750 ml-$42,164-1,016

6, Martini and Rossi Vermouth Sweet 1 L- 1L-$41,048-4,109

7, Kim Crawford Sauvignon Blanc Marlborough-750 ml-$41,000-2,462

8, Santa Margherita Pinot Grigio-750 ml-$39,611-1,655

9, Veuve Clicquot Yellow Label Champagne Brut-750 ml-$36,563-690

10, The Palm by Whispering Angel Rose-750 ml-$36,120-2,367

Liquor

Includes the product, liquid volume, sales amount and sales quantity

1, Tito’s Handmade Vodka 80 Proof-1 L-$1,304,779-50,204

2, Jack Daniel’s Old No 7 Black Label Tennessee Whiskey 80 Proof-750 ml-$388,123-16,519

3, Jameson Irish Whiskey 80 Proof-750 ml-$364,021-12,580

4, Tito’s Handmade Vodka 80 Proof-750 ml-$337,750-17,993

5, Maker’s Mark Straight Bourbon 90 Proof-750 ml-$262,617-9,326

6, Woodford Reserve Straight Bourbon 90 Proof-750 ml-$245,946-6,976

7, Tanqueray London Dry Gin 94 Proof-750 ml-$241,163-9,295

8, Captain Morgan Original Spiced Rum 70 Proof-750 ml-$240,155-13,385

9, Grey Goose Vodka 80 Proof 750 ml-$228,617-6,944

10, Fireball Cinnamon Whisky 66 Proof-750 ml-$202,343-10,975

Curbside only, April 20-May 7

Wine

Includes the product, liquid volume, sales amount and sales quantity

1, Franzia Chardonnay 5 L-5L-$90,611-4,739

2, Franzia Pinot Grigio Columbard 5 -5L-$71,803-3,751

3, Woodbridge by Robert Mondavi Chardonnay-1.5 L-$70,589-4,808

4, Cavit Pinot Grigio-1.5 L-$66,764-04,592

5, Kendall Jackson Vintner’s Reserve Chardonnay-750 ml-$63,644-4,088

6, Franzia Cabernet Sauvignon 5 L-5 L-$61,840-3,236

7, Almaden Chardonnay 5 L-5 L-$60,132-2,865

8, Franzia Sunset Blush 5 L-5L $56,740-3,308

9, La Marca Prosecco-750 ml-$56,514-3,387

10, Franzia White Zinfandel 5 L-5 L-$54,841-2,764

Liquor

Includes the product, liquid volume, sales amount and sales quantity

1, Tito’s Handmade Vodka 80 Proof-1.75 L-$1,269,159-35,274

2, Hennessy Cognac VS 80 Proof-750 ml-$489,303-12,913

3, Captain Morgan Original Spiced Rum 70 Proof-1.75 L-$469,216-18,368

4, Jack Daniel’s Old No 7 Black Label Tennessee Whiskey 80 Proof-1.75 L-$463,152-10,582

5, Patron Tequila Silver 80 Proof-750 ml-$326,291-6,160

6, Bacardi Superior Rum 80 Proof-1.75 L-$283,542-13,275

7, Jack Daniel’s Old No 7 Black Label Tennessee Whiskey 80 Proof-750 ml-$266,636-11,223

8, Tito’s Handmade Vodka 80 Proof-750 ml-$252,907-13,863

9, Jameson Irish Whiskey 80 Proof-1.75 L-$244,577-4,016

10, Absolut Vodka 80 Proof-1.75 L-$239,053-7,738

Total retail (online and curbside), since May 8

Wine

Includes the product, liquid volume, sales amount and sales quantity

1, Franzia Chardonnay 5 L-5 L-$265,026-13,811

2, La Marca Prosecco-750 ml-$220,913-13,025

3, Kendall Jackson Vintner’s Reserve Chardonnay-750 ml-$217,707-13,678

4, Franzia Pinot Grigio Columbard 5 L-5 L-$217,214-11,300

5, Woodbridge by Robert Mondavi Chardonnay-750 ml-$207,891-14,622

6, Cavit Pinot Grigio-750 ml-$194,874-13,048

7, Franzia Sunset Blush 5 L-5 L-$161,360-09,374

8, Apothic Red Winemaker’s Blend-750 ml-$160,044-14,177

9, Kim Crawford Sauvignon Blanc Marlborough-750 ml-$152,444-9,321

10, Almaden Chardonna 5 L-5L-$149,387-7,222

Liquor

Includes the product, liquid volume, sales amount and sales quantity

1, Tito’s Handmade Vodka 80 Proof-1.75 L-$3,542,695-100,970

2, Hennessy Cognac VS 80 Proof-750 ml-$1,905,957-50,211

3, Captain Morgan Original Spiced Rum 70 Proof-1.75 L-$1,288,244-50,392

4, Jack Daniel’s Old No 7 Black Label Tennessee Whiskey 80 Proof-1.75 L-$1,181,423-27,044

5, Tito’s Handmade Vodka 80 Proof-750 ml-$891,377-48,822

6, Bacardi Superior Rum 80 Proof 1.75 L-$835,266-39,066

7, Crown Royal Regal Apple Canadian Whisky 70 Proof-750 ml-$809,473-30,535

8, Patron Tequila Silver 80 Proof-750 ml-$800,728-15,422

9, Jack Daniel’s Old No 7 Black Label Tennessee Whiskey 80 Proof-750 ml-$749,738-31,516

10, Jameson Irish Whiskey 80 Proof-750 ml-$724,265-26,104
